I have the Bernina 350 PE and it's heavy. I can't imagine that the Special Edition would be any lighter. The only weight I found for the SE on-line was 8kg which is about 17.5 pounds - mine feels heavier than that. I got a lighter machine to take to classes (maybe about 12 lbs).

PS I do love my 350 though for home sewing/quilting - I wish I could carry it everywhere!
